Taking the bus is the best way to travel to Zaragoza without flying. The bus trip is an affordable, safe and convenient way to travel between the two cities. Taking a ride with other travelers through carpool services is an additional option to consider.
Traveling from Motril to Zaragoza takes around 12h 30m on average, although the minimum time it takes to get there is 11h 55m with the fastest bus. This is the time it takes to travel the 367 miles (592 km) that separate the two cities.
Motril and Zaragoza are 367 miles (592 km) apart.
About 3 buses travel this route daily, provided by ALSA. The number of buses from Motril to Zaragoza can differ depending on the day of the week. The bus service operates from 10:00 AM for the initial departure and runs until 5:05 PM for the final departure.
Most of the buses traveling from Motril to Zaragoza leave from Calle Tegucigalpa and arrive at Estación intermodal de Zaragoza-Delicias. Buses are energy-efficient. Carrying a passenger over 100 kms by coach only takes 0.6-0.9 liters of gas. Compare that to the 2.6 liters required by high-speed train, 6.6 liters by airplane and 7.6 liters by gas-powered car, and it's clear that the bus is a more environmentally-conscious option for your bus transportation from Motril to Zaragoza.

Did you know?
The word 'bus' is an abbreviation of 'omnibus" which means 'for all' in Latin as buses were meant to be transportation for everybody.
One of the longest bus route in the world goes all the way from Ontario to Alberta in Canada (with the same bus). This trip is 3,435 km or 2,135 miles long and the price is a bit under $100.
9.2% of ground transportation in Europe is done by bus versus 7.4% by train.
